The CAGED guitar theory system is built on five basic open chord shapes: C chord. A chord. G chord. E chord. D chord. Hence the name, CAGED. Each open chord form is moveable, which means it can be played in other locations up and down the fretboard. Our Music Theory journey …The numbers 1, 4, and 5 refer to degrees in the major scale. For example, in the C major scale, the 1st note is C, the 4th note is F and the 5th note is G. In the key of C, C, F, and G are all played as major chords. Any song that makes use of these chords is considered a type of “1 4 5” chord progression. For example, “La Bamba.”.
